The Parallel Groove Clamp is primarily used for connecting two conductors together. Its design ensures that electrical connections are secure, which is incredibly important in preventing power loss or equipment failure. One of the key advantages of Parallel Groove Clamps is their versatility. They can be used in numerous applications, such as overhead power lines, earthing systems, and even renewable energy projects like solar panels. Security is another major benefit of using these clamps. Designed to maintain a strong grip, Parallel Groove Clamps minimize the risk of loosening over time due to vibration or environmental factors. This durability means that once you install these clamps, you can usually trust them to perform consistently for years. Now, let’s talk about installation. While some may shy away from this aspect, you'll find that installing Parallel Groove Clamps is relatively straightforward. Here’s a simplified example: imagine you need to join two wire ends. Instead of fumbling with complicated soldering or other methods, you simply position the wires side by side, place the clamp over them, and tighten it. This ease of use means that even if you're not a seasoned professional, you can achieve reliable results.
